The present disclosure integrates an actuated tilting rehabilitation table, video tracking of the patient arm and opposite shoulder, a low-friction forearm support with grasping force sensing, remote data transmission and additional weighing means, one or more large displays, a computer and a plurality of simulation exercises, such as video games. The patient can be monitored by a local or remote clinician. The table tilts in order to increase exercise difficulty due to gravity loading on the patient's arm and shoulder. In one embodiment, the actuated tilting table tilts in four degrees of freedom.

Various embodiments are provided for providing byte granularity accessibility of memory in a unified memory-storage hierarchy in a computing system by a processor. A location of one or more secondary memory medium pages in a secondary memory medium may be mapped into an address space of a primary memory medium to extend a memory-storage hierarchy of the secondary memory medium. The one or more secondary memory medium pages may be promoted from the secondary memory medium to the primary memory medium. The primary memory medium functions as a cache to provide byte level accessibility to the one or more primary memory medium pages. A memory request for the secondary memory medium page may be redirected using a promotion look-aside buffer (“PLB”) in a host bridge associated with the primary memory medium and the secondary memory medium.

A gesture recognition biofeedback device is provided for improving fine motor function in persons with brain injury. The system detects a physical characteristic of the patient and provides feedback based on the detected characteristic. For instance, the system may detect surface muscle pressures of the forearm to provide real-time visual biofeedback to the patient based on a comparison of the detected muscle pressure and predefined values indicative of appropriate motor function.
